Output ab8c8c220d1d040ca6aeb39eb30176dcffc9b2d8e2ad37d278475b49f535e3f6:0

value
17085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71b6f86d879a67f583ad73da3ab9f222ac4257d2 OP_EQUAL
address
3C4HUECNr8PPu9RaUVxEuDN69dzp5zAFQQ
transaction
ab8c8c220d1d040ca6aeb39eb30176dcffc9b2d8e2ad37d278475b49f535e3f6
spent
true